Gifted and talented in the early years : practical activities for children aged 3 to 5 /
Drawing from her own personal experiences of teaching gifted and talented pupils, the author describes ideas and activities that have been proven to help them flourish, as well as enabling other children to gain from this imaginative approach to learning.
